Hey Tico,

If you are looking for a kit of the Newport Class LST, Orange Hobby makes a USS Newport LST-1179 in 1/700 scale(Resin Kit). I posted a link from Free Time Hobbies site to show the kit. But a few places I get my kits form have it out of stock. You might get lucky doing an internet search for a shop that has it in stock...
http://freetimehobbies.com/1-700-orange ... -lst-1179/

If you are looking for 1/350 scale. Iron Shipwrights has the USS Newport LST-1179 in 1/350(Resin Kit).
http://ironshipwrights.com/pages/Newport.html
http://freetimehobbies.com/1-350-iron-s ... 1179-1985/

Hope this helps in your search for the kits you are looking for...

JAG is no longer in business; their molds were picked up by Admiralty Modelworks, which hasn't resumed production on all of the JAG molds.

by sgtryan13 » Fri Jul 22, 2016 9:10 am

I have it, and as with all the other orange hobby kits, the casting is beautiful. For the pricetag though, I am a little disappointed. NO aircraft, one single M-1 Abrams tank, and NO connex boxes which are a staple on the deck of these ships.

The design of the kit will make painting the welldeck a challenge, and even more of a challenge if you want to illuminate the welldeck.

This is going to be a commission for a customer, I had intended on getting one for myself, but after looking through the kit and comparing it with the pricetag, I opted to spend my $$$ on other stuff.

Anyone built the Lindberg LSD? Odd box scale of 1/288 but I've read about some people using some of the 1/300 or 1/250 PE sets for detail. Lindberg did a pretty good job on this old kit for the time and the major complaints seem to be focused on the weapons.

GHQ http://www.ghqmodels.com has a selection of 1:285 vehicles that could be used to fill the LCVPs and other craft...

Mark,

Floating Drydock has plans for LSD-45 as built and since the 49s are modified 41s (same hulls) they should work just fine. As far as I know the only real changes were all internal and to the well deck and vehicle/cargo storage. Just get a bunch of photos from Navsource and Navy Newsstand and you should be good.

The following link to NARA shows operations of a Casa Grande Class LSD during the Korean War. You'll see the USS Cabildo (LSD-16) supporting mine sweeping operations off of Wonson Harbor, where the sweeping is being performed by MinRon 3, using LCVP's. Rather than overall shots of the LSD, there are lots of shots of well deck operations.
